Why Pray?
Prayer is the heart of Christianity, because at the heart of Christianity is a relationship with God. We pray to the Father who is in Heaven, through the Son in Jesus' name being empowered by the Holy Spirit. We learn to communicate to our Father; we learn to listen to what He has to say to us as a body, as individuals.Through Jesus' earthly ministry, He was focused on doing the will of His Father, which was achieved through prayer. Making His requests known to the Father and receiving direction from Him. Jesus remained attached to the Father through prayer.Prayer brings a person into the presence of God. Our relationship with Him grows and develops as a result of prayer.

1 Thessalonians 5: 16-18
16 Be joyful always; 17 pray continually; 18 give thanks in all circumstances, for this is God's will for you in Christ Jesus.
